Admirals arch
after remarkable rocks and a 30 minute drive down the winding dirt road we ended up at "admirals arch", at first you couldn't see anything but what seemed like a long wooden pathway and stairs leading down from the beach, but as you got further down the path you discovered beautiful parts of the ocean...
then as you reached the bottom of the last flight of wooden steps the most amazing sight was unravelled this left me speechless for a while (or maybe it was the fear of sea water entering my mouth? LOL)
After the amazing experience of admirals arch we took another 2 hour bus drive through Flinders chase national park which was unfortunately slightly bare looking due to a fire 4 years ago, but it was nether the less still beautiful. It was another 2 hour drive back to penneshaw after going through the national park and stopping for some walking on the trails (although we didnt really see anythng). When we got back we had some fish and chips and relaxed for the rest of the night.
